Inferential Statistics
A branch of statistics that allows us to make predictions or inferences about a population based on sample data.
Generalize
To draw broad conclusions from specific instances, making the information applicable to a larger group or situation.
Population
The total number of inhabitants of a particular town, area, country, or the total number of individuals within a specific group or category.
